1. CUDA
查看 cuda 版本号
nvidia-smi
下载 CUDA 安装包 https://developer.nvidia.com/cuda-downloads
照着提示安装 cuda
wget https://developer.download.nvidia.com/compute/cuda/repos/ubuntu2004/x86_64/cuda-ubuntu2004.pin
sudo mv cuda-ubuntu2004.pin /etc/apt/preferences.d/cuda-repository-pin-600
wget https://developer.download.nvidia.com/compute/cuda/11.4.2/local_installers/cuda-repo-ubuntu2004-11-4-local_11.4.2-470.57.02-1_amd64.deb
sudo dpkg -i cuda-repo-ubuntu2004-11-4-local_11.4.2-470.57.02-1_amd64.deb
sudo apt-key add /var/cuda-repo-ubuntu2004-11-4-local/7fa2af80.pub
sudo apt-get update
sudo apt-get -y install cuda
添加 cuda 环境变量
export PATH=/usr/local/cuda/bin${PATH:+:${PATH}}
export LD_LIBRARY_PATH=/usr/local/cuda/lib64${LD_LIBRARY_PATH:+:${LD_LIBRARY_PATH}}
更新环境变量
source ~/.bashrc
验证安装是否成功
nvcc -V
2. CUDNN
下载 cudnn https://developer.nvidia.com/zh-cn/cudnn (需要注册)
解压
tar zxvf cudnn-11.4-linux-x64-v8.2.4.15.tgz
把 CUDNN 文件复制到 CUDA 的对应文件夹(插入式设计)
sudo cp cuda/include/cudnn*.h /usr/local/cuda/include
sudo cp cuda/lib64/libcudnn* /usr/local/cuda/lib64/
sudo chmod a+r /usr/local/cuda/include/cudnn*.h
sudo chmod a+r /usr/local/cuda/lib64/libcudnn*
查看安装情况
cat /usr/local/cuda/include/cudnn_version.h | grep CUDNN_MAJOR -A 2
3. Miniconda
下载 https://docs.conda.io/en/latest/miniconda.html
安装
bash Miniconda3-latest-Linux-x86_64.sh
测试安装是否成功
conda list
如果不想看见 base
conda config --set auto_activate_base false
4. conda 使用
5. Pycharm
下载 https://www.jetbrains.com/zh-cn/pycharm/download/#section=linux
解压
tar zxvf pycharm-professional-2021.2.2.tar.gz
安装
sudo mkdir /opt/pycharm
sudo mv pycharm-2021.2.2/ /opt/pycharm/
启动
sh /opt/pycharm/pycharm-2021.2.2/bin/pycharm.sh
桌面图标放进应用程序